Coogee is a suburb of Perth, Western Australia, located within the City of Cockburn. Neighbouring suburbs surround it include North Coogee, Spearwood, Munster and Cockburn Sound, as wells as being bordered by the Indian Ocean.
Established in the 1980’s the suburb of 'Coogee' takes its name from the lake in the area. Originally, this lake was named Lake Munster after Prince William, the Earl of Munster and later King William IV. The Aboriginal name Kou-Gee meaning “body of water” and variously spelt as Koojee, Coojee and Coogee, which gradually gained pre-eminence over the old name.
Coogee features many facilities and amenities for its residents to enjoy, with Coogee Beach on the Indian Ocean, Coogee Primary School and Powell and Poole Reserves.
